## Runbook: Fanout Backpressure (Notifier Plugins)

When the Quillcast fan-out queue exceeds its high-water mark, plugin delivery is throttled, not dropped. Do not retry aggressively; honor the backoff header. Symptoms: delayed pushes, rising ack latency. Check that your plugin targets the current verified runtime before filing a report, since stale builds ignore backpressure signals. Reports without a build reference are closed automatically. Include the token shown below in every report.

pipeline stamp: htk31_f769b577b3028a4e9958e5bb8d1259a

# Build Provenance — Splitwire Assignment Service

Splitwire assigns A/B experiment buckets. Every deploy is built from a tagged commit on the release branch; no hotpatches, ever. If assignments look skewed, first confirm the running build matches the provenance record before touching config. Rollbacks go through the standard pipeline — do not redeploy old artifacts by hand. Verify the checksum against the registry entry. The provenance token for the current production build is recorded immediately below.

session token of taduf-tahog = htk4_91a1

## Support

The nightly reindex for Lanternsearch runs at 01:30 from the Ashgrove scheduler. If it fails, check the indexer logs first; most failures are shard lock timeouts and clear on rerun. Do not trigger a manual full reindex during business hours — it doubles query latency. Partial reindexes are safe anytime. Dashboards live under the Lanternsearch board in Gridview. Raise anything unresolved at the weekly eng sync, or for urgent issues outside the sync, email the search platform rotation below.

escalation mailbox, fafof-bahip: tamael@ordincorp.test

Corvid's migration runner, Shiftstone, does zero-downtime schema changes via expand/contract: add columns first, backfill, then drop old ones in a later release. On-call engineers never run migrations by hand; the runner picks them up automatically. It authenticates to the schema registry with a credential loaded from its env file, so append the following line there.

vault entry, yahif-yajep: COURIER_KEY29=b802bdf8034096b65a51c6ba5abe2